madwifi driver


hey guys,
i just loaded up the madwifi drivers for an orinoco a/b/g combo card, and i didn't get any errors during 'make' or 'make install'. when i type iwconfig, it picks up the card, but it can't seem to find any APs. they are being discovered by other equipment. when i put in the orinoco b card, it picks them up right away. is there something i need to do to activate the madwifi drivers? the lights on the card are flashing, but it doesn't seem to be transmitting or receiving. any help would be appreciated.

i would just like to say that i retract my question, and that i'm an idiot. i forgot to type 'ifconfig ath0 up'
